The deluxes are considered deluxes due to their location primarily, followed by their theming/amenities. Because you do not have to take a bus to all parks, it's a deluxe. IF you want to pay more in room rates, then fine....allow Disney to provide resort specific buses. But I highly doubt Disney is going to put a bus into service for the CR/BLT, than another bus for just the Polynesian, and then a bus just for the GF. Same for the Epcot resorts.

In all actuality??? You know what resort has the hands down, best bus service??? Pop!! Issue is that Pop is large, so they need to have more frequent buses running.....then, the buses make no further stops since they are usually close to full already. But, the GF??? Just not that many people there..comparitively speaking.
